Output dba84f6434293bf883497721979f22565ea993d2f17e2f563efc4c86bc1b20f6:31

value
18840
script pubkey
OP_0 OP_PUSHBYTES_20 4ec750b8ce0cc24e500ab47ff67f8a4aee117e85
address
bc1qfmr4pwxwpnpyu5q2k3llvlu2fthpzl59eah72j
transaction
dba84f6434293bf883497721979f22565ea993d2f17e2f563efc4c86bc1b20f6
spent
true